Transaction 95db07603f949b17af246798ea8d732b80d6dccc1022bd974d32300d9fd86f5c

2 Input
2 Outputs
  • 95db07603f949b17af246798ea8d732b80d6dccc1022bd974d32300d9fd86f5c:0
  • value  300494
    address  1HchVpSrc69oxdemZdeozuAHvCUNdTYckE
  • 95db07603f949b17af246798ea8d732b80d6dccc1022bd974d32300d9fd86f5c:1
  • value  1374100
    address  3HrhFgPcpN4c5R4B91StNbwufnCo5YnhVd